Hopton Titterhill
Hopton Titterhill is a peak in Hopton Castle, Shropshire, England and has an elevation of 1,302 feet. Hopton Titterhill is situated nearby to the village Hopton Castle, as well as near Bedstone.Places of Interest

Hopton Heath railway station
Railway station

Hopton Heath railway station in Hopton Heath, Shropshire, England, lies on the Heart of Wales Line, 25+1⁄2 miles south west of Shrewsbury. The station is in a very rural area: the nearest sizeable settlement is Hopton Castle, and further afield the larger villages of Clungunford and Leintwardine, Herefordshire.

Bucknell railway station serves the village of Bucknell in Shropshire, England 28+1⁄4 miles south west of Shrewsbury on the Heart of Wales Line. This railway station is located at street level, adjacent to the level crossing and parallel with Weston Road near the centre of the village.

Hopton Castle is a small village and civil parish in south Shropshire, England. The village grew up near the keep of Hopton Castle, which was opened as a visitor attraction in 2011.

Bedstone is a small village and civil parish in south Shropshire, England, close to the border with Herefordshire. The village is approximately 1+1⁄2 miles from the railway stations at Hopton Heath and Bucknell and is situated just off the B4367 road.

Twitchen is a hamlet in Shropshire, England, on the B4385 south of Purslow and near to Hopton Castle. The southern part of the settlement is called Three Ashes.
